AI Summary

  • Expands Virginia's ban on non-compete agreements to include health care professionals licensed by the Boards of Medicine, Nursing, Counseling, Optometry, Psychology, or Social Work, in addition to the existing ban for low-wage employees

  • Employers violating the non-compete prohibition face a $10,000 civil penalty per violation, and affected employees may bring civil action within two years to void agreements and recover damages, lost compensation, and attorney fees

  • Permits non-compete agreements with health care professionals only when part of a sale of a business involving substantially all operating assets and goodwill, provided the covenant is reasonable in scope, duration, and geographic area

  • Allows employers to require health care professionals employed fewer than five years to repay recruitment-related costs including relocation expenses, signing bonuses, and training expenses upon departure

  • Employers may still include provisions preventing health care professionals from soliciting customers with whom they had material contact during employment for a stated period after termination

Legislative Description

Covenants not to compete; includes health care professionals, civil penalty.
